Matt Mangriotis said the 450i can be powered and timed from a CMM4 (if it has the 56VDC supply installed obviously), but you'll have to change the pinout on your cat5 end. Not sure what that needs to be, but it's probably in a document somewhere.

I don't know if the 320/430 SyncInjector would work. It is 48/56VDC, but you have the stupid split pair power, which I'm sure could be adapted with a pinout change. However, since the 450i is 802.3at, is it power over the 10/100 data lines only (1,2,3&6? which wouldn't work from the SyncInjector) or does it also accept power on the "spare" pairs? 320 and 430 are definitely different than 450. 450i may have gone to the goofy wiring standard again, but I doubt it as it's not a replacement for the 450.

FFR the spec sheet says 48-59 V DC, 802.3at compliant
